摘要
Aiming at improving the knowledge management in PPP projects, the development of an ontology-based knowledge base for Residual Value Risk (RVR) in PPPs was conducted. Through literature review and typical case study of knowledge management in PPP projects, the RVR in PPP projects was analyzed from the perspective of risk structure, risk process and vulnerability, based on which the formation mechanism of RVR was explored. The RVR was deconstructed into five risk consequences. Furthermore, an improved RVR framework was established as a platform for organizing all kinds of knowledge for RVR in PPPs. Meanwhile, in order to express knowledge more effectively and promote their sharedness and transferability, the knowledge base was built by means of ontology. Finally, the ontology editing software Protege was used to build ontology-based RVR knowledge base, to achieve a more in-depth data processing function. The study can be used to analyze risk probability and vulnerability for both of public and private sectors in PPPs.
